Floyd's Death 'Absolutely Preventable,' Doctor Says In Chauvin Trial

"I can state with a high degree of medical certainty that George Floyd did not die from a primary cardiac event and he did not die from a drug overdose," cardiologist Dr. Jonathan Rich says.
